1. TD Aeroplan Visa Infinite Card
This card is well-suited for frequent Air Canada travelers. It earns 1.5 Aeroplan points per dollar on travel-related purchases and 1 point per dollar on other spending. Points can be redeemed for flights, upgrades, and partner services in the Aeroplan network.
Features
- Aeroplan point accumulation for both travel and everyday purchases
- Emergency medical and travel accident insurance
- Coverage for delayed or lost luggage
Its combination of airline rewards and travel protections makes it a reliable option for those traveling regularly with Air Canada or its partners.
2. Scotiabank Gold American Express Card
This card offers strong value by eliminating foreign transaction fees and providing high rewards on popular spending categories.
Features
- No foreign currency conversion fees on international purchases
- Earn Scotia Rewards points on restaurants, groceries, and entertainment
- Competitive point redemption options for travel, merchandise, or statement credit
It appeals to users who want to avoid currency conversion costs while earning rewards on lifestyle expenses that often occur during trips.
3. BMO World Elite Mastercard
Designed for premium travelers, this card combines high rewards rates with access to airport lounges and strong insurance coverage.
Features
- 3 BMO Rewards points per dollar on travel purchases
- Complimentary LoungeKey access to 1,000+ lounges worldwide
- Comprehensive insurance, including trip cancellation, interruption, and emergency medical
- No foreign transaction fees
This card is suitable for frequent flyers who value comfort, convenience, and broad redemption options through the BMO Rewards portal.
4. American Express Cobalt Card
A standout for food and beverage purchases, the Cobalt Card is ideal for those who frequently dine out or travel.
Features
- 5 Membership Rewards points per dollar on dining and food delivery
- 2 points per dollar on travel purchases
- Transferable points to hotel and airline partners
Its strong earning categories and flexible redemption options make it a valuable everyday card for those who blend travel with a culinary lifestyle.
5. RBC Avion Visa Infinite Card
This card offers broad airline compatibility and redemption flexibility, allowing users to avoid blackout dates when booking flights.
Features
- Redeem Avion points across multiple airlines
- Emergency medical, trip cancellation, and baggage insurance
- No blackout dates or seat restrictions on flights booked through the Avion program
It supports spontaneous travel planning and provides dependable insurance protection while abroad.

6. Capital One Aspire Travel World Elite Mastercard
This card combines a large welcome bonus with a straightforward and flexible rewards system.
Features
- Earn 2x miles on dining and entertainment
- Redeem miles across a wide range of airlines with no blackout dates
- Option to transfer points to partner airline programs
It’s a practical card for travelers who want flexible rewards and a quick path to free travel.
7. HSBC World Elite Mastercard
This option blends cashback flexibility with travel perks, appealing to users looking for both savings and premium benefits.
Features
- Global airport lounge access
- Points earned on all purchases and redeemable for travel, merchandise, or credit
- Transfer options to airline and hotel loyalty programs
- No foreign transaction fees
The HSBC World Elite Mastercard provides a broad suite of rewards and international travel advantages, especially for users with diverse booking preferences.
8. National Bank Travel Platinum Mastercard
Designed for flexible travel redemptions, this card is suited for users who prefer a simplified rewards model.
Features
- Redeem points for flights, hotels, car rentals, and travel packages
- Travel insurance coverage, including emergency medical and baggage protection
- No foreign transaction fees
It offers useful flexibility for users planning a range of travel styles from organized tours to last-minute vacations.
9. Desjardins Odyssey World Elite Mastercard
This card focuses on elevated service and benefits for both domestic and international travelers.
Features
- Accelerated points on travel purchases
- Extensive travel insurance, including trip interruption and emergency medical
- Access to global airport lounges
- 24/7 concierge services
- No foreign transaction fees
Strong customer support and flexible point usage make it an attractive choice for frequent travelers who value premium experiences.
10. Sun Life Financial Optimize+ Credit Card
Uniquely positioned in the travel card space, this card integrates healthcare and wellness-related spending.
Features
- Supports Health Spending Accounts (HSAs)
- Bonus rewards on wellness-related travel
- No foreign transaction fees
The card is suited for users prioritizing health and wellness while traveling, including those participating in medical tourism or retreats.
11. PC Financial World Elite Mastercard
With a focus on grocery rewards and no annual fee, this card helps travelers save before and during their trips.
Features
- 30 PC Optimum points per $1 spent at participating food retailers
- Redeemable points for groceries and other essentials
- No annual fee
- Accepted internationally with widespread merchant support
Its strong grocery rewards and no-cost structure provide everyday savings for travel-minded consumers.

Frequently Asked Questions
What is the best travel credit card in Canada right now?
There is no single best card for everyone. Cards like the BMO World Elite Mastercard or RBC Avion Visa Infinite are popular for frequent flyers, while the Scotiabank Gold American Express offers strong value for international travelers avoiding foreign fees.
Do travel credit cards in Canada cover travel insurance?
Yes, many premium cards offer travel insurance, including emergency medical, trip cancellation, lost baggage, and accident coverage. Always check the policy details before relying on them.
Are travel credit card points taxable in Canada?
Generally, credit card rewards are not considered taxable if they are earned through personal spending. However, if points are earned through business expenses and converted to cash or used personally, tax implications may apply.
What does “no foreign transaction fee” mean?
It means the card issuer does not charge extra for converting foreign currency when you make purchases outside Canada. This can save 2.5% to 3% per transaction compared to cards that do apply such fees.
Can points from travel cards be transferred to airline programs?
Some cards, like the American Express Cobalt or HSBC World Elite offer transfer options to airline and hotel partners. Others may restrict redemption to their own portals or networks.
